Amy, 34, wrote a letter to our editorial and told us her story. The woman wasn\u2019t hiding her emotions and by sharing her story, she intended to warn our readers that it\u2019s worth thinking twice if you ever decide to renew your relationship with a person who once let you down.\n

Amy opened her letter, saying, \u00abI and my husband Dan, 36, had been sweethearts since middle school. We had been dating for over 8 years and then we got married. Our marriage was turbulent, with a lot of fights and even infidelity from Dan\u2019s side, which I only suspected but which, however, was denied by him and was never confirmed by facts. I found some provoking messages from his colleague at a time on his phone and decided that it was time to call it quits. I didn\u2019t listen to his excuses, and I sincerely didn\u2019t want any explanations anymore. My trust in Dan had already been shaken a lot after he demonstrated very infantile behavior during some really hard times we were going through. So, I initiated our divorce and he gave up after several attempts to reason with me.\u00bb\n

Amy goes on with her story, saying, \u00abSo, we divorced 3 years ago and I avoided any contact with Dan for a very long time. I did receive some invitations for a cup of coffee from him, but I ignored every attempt of Dan to get closer again. But around one year ago, we accidentally met in a supermarket. I went to buy some groceries and he was there, too, accompanied by some beautiful lady.\u00bb\n

Amy revealed, \u00abWhen I saw Dan with another woman, I instantly became extremely jealous. Of course, I remembered that we divorced and that he was a free man from then on. But something inside me just didn\u2019t let him go all this time, and seeing him with another woman was very hurtful and offensive to me.\u00bb\n

Amy wrote that Dan called her that very same day when they met in the supermarket, and she decided to answer his call this time. The woman wrote, \u00abI was surprised by the purpose of Dan\u2019s call. He called to explain that the woman he was accompanied by, was his father\u2019s secretary and that his dad just asked him to bring her home because she hurt her leg badly. Dan added that their visit to that supermarket was the woman\u2019s initiative, she just asked him for a favor and he couldn\u2019t say no.\u00bb\n

The woman added, \u00abI believed Dan, because I saw that the woman was limping, so the whole story sounded legit to me. Dan then suggested meeting for a talk, and this time I agreed.\u00bb\n

Amy wrote, \u00abThe first moment\u00a0I saw Dan after that encounter in\u00a0a\u00a0supermarket, stroke me\u00a0like lightning. I\u00a0realized that\u00a0I was still so\u00a0in\u00a0love with him. Dan was holding my\u00a0hand throughout the evening and was very delicate and attentive. Then he\u00a0drove me\u00a0home and in\u00a0the car he\u00a0kissed\u00a0me. It\u00a0was like a\u00a0flashback from our school years when he\u00a0first kissed me\u00a0on\u00a0our first date. I\u00a0gave\u00a0up, and he\u00a0moved in\u00a0the next day. We\u00a0started our relationship on\u00a0the new page. It\u00a0was awesome and\u00a0I was totally happy. Up\u00a0until one day, when he\u00a0disappointed me\u00a0again.\u00bb\n

Amy goes on\u00a0with her story, saying, \u00abOne day, Dan woke me\u00a0up\u00a0at\u00a06\u00a0am and told me\u00a0to\u00a0wake up\u00a0because he\u00a0wanted to\u00a0take me\u00a0to\u00a0the spa. I\u00a0was very surprised because it\u00a0wasn\u2019t a\u00a0special day or\u00a0anniversary, but sure\u00a0I was all in\u00a0for\u00a0it. At\u00a0the spa, Dan told me\u00a0how he\u00a0wanted to\u00a0go\u00a0to\u00a0a\u00a0fancy restaurant after we\u00a0were done at\u00a0the spa, and that he\u00a0had a\u00a0surprise for\u00a0me. Of\u00a0course, I\u00a0agreed.\u00bb\n

The woman revealed, \u00abWe\u00a0then got to\u00a0the restaurant, we\u00a0had an\u00a0amazing and romantic dinner and just a\u00a0nice time in\u00a0general. We\u00a0were going through our memories and building some plans for the future. We\u00a0even talked about trying to\u00a0have kids.\u00bb\n

Then, the situation took a\u00a0bizarre and unpleasant turn. Amy recalled, \u00abAfter around 50\u00a0minutes Dan stood up\u00a0and got on\u00a0his knees. He\u00a0took out a\u00a0box out of\u00a0his pocket. My\u00a0heart stopped beating, as\u00a0I hadn\u2019t even predicted this. He\u00a0made a\u00a0speech about how\u00a0I was the most beautiful woman in\u00a0the world and how he\u00a0missed me\u00a0when we\u00a0were apart. He\u00a0ended the speech with \u201eWill you marry me\u00a0again my\u00a0queen?\u201c. Of\u00a0course, I\u00a0said yes!\u00bb\n

Amy goes on, saying, \u00abSeconds later all that excitement turned into an absolute horror for me. Dan opened that small box and I sincerely expected he had put the ring in it. But it contained a note saying \u201eyou\u2019ve been pranked!\u201c and Dan started laughing hysterically.\u00bb\n

Amy revealed, \u00abHe continued with \u201eHoney, this was just a prank! I\u2019m not ready at all to remarry you yet!\u201c. He was about to hug me but I gave him the biggest slap ever with tears streaming down my face. I just told him, \u201eWe\u2019re over you the nightmare of my life\u201c.\u00bb\n

Amy shared that Dan had been texting and calling her for a month after that incident, but felt so sad, betrayed, and very angry. The woman confessed, \u00abI thought this was going to be one of the best days of my life. But I learned a lesson that you really cannot step into the same river twice. And, though it was a hard-earned lesson for me, I\u2019m ready to move forward without him and now I\u2019m sure that I divorced Dan for a reason.\u00bb\n
